  • My first hole in one

    I was playing through two couples on the 4th hole at Dolphin Head GC on Hilton Head, SC when I knocked in a 6 iron from 173yds. It was nice to see the people clapping and excited as I was. It turns out I ended up shooting my lowest score for 18 (73).
